Statedancer, historically has been a 4 piece - Matt Bolter and Rob Green on guitar and vocals, Kirstie Stuart on Bass and Nicole Wiemann on drums. Matt and Rob have been writing songs for a few years before the band got all parts together to rehearse, in Matt''s Cellar in Sale, Manchester from March 2004. The first gigs began in November of that year, upstairs at the Internet Cafe ''Fuel'' in Withington, Manchester, England. The lads knew Kirstie quite a few years beforehand - Kirst had dallied in quite a few bands in the 90s- as guitarist and singer, then Rob met the drummer, Nic while working in a Call Centre in Manchester in 2003. Once gigs began - all around Manchester - then venturing out of the city - into London, Liverpool and elsewhere - there was a few interviews with the BBC GMR, Phil Jupitus reviewed their song Milkman Murders,(a song that will be available on our second release later in 2008) on BBC Radio 6, Paul Gambaccini reviewed their cd and the band received regular airplay from Clint Boon on his The Revolution radio station based in Oldham. Writing for this album began at the beginning of 2006 and finished in Jan 2008 - so is a true representation on a full 2 years work.
